Output f30baea31bfb34c32cda62a87b75466838fdeec3342b5cd6724634cd779ae0f8:30

value
14573508
script pubkey
OP_0 OP_PUSHBYTES_20 d34a50375b4e8e891db7078f572df125069114ae
address
ltc1q6d99qd6mf68gj8dhq784wt03y5rfz99wxdtfgs
transaction
f30baea31bfb34c32cda62a87b75466838fdeec3342b5cd6724634cd779ae0f8
spent
true